The Molls: White Stains b/w Is Chesty Dead?
7" 45rpm. Skids Records. TAR-0102. 1979
Vinyl and cover (great sci-fi/horror drawing on front, cover in card-stock) both in excellent condition. Cover beginning to come unglued.
Early Boston punk/art band, featuring an electric bassoon and Peter Prescott (his next band was Mission of Burma) on drums. King Krimson hurls itself at Pere Ubu and everyone comes out for the worse! "Black Sheets, White Stains" is a truly terrifying and great sonic slab. They did a few shows with The Moving Parts at Cantone's. After Prescott and the bassoonist left, the rest of the lads moved on to Someone and the Somebodies, co-winning the Boston Rumble, and also Auto 66, continuing their odd meld of art and rock. Tris Lozaw also became a music critic in the Boston area. The B-side was about the well-endowed porn star Chesty Morgan.
Rob Davis: lead guitar, ARP 2600, vocals
Tristram Lozaw: bass, inside-out guitars, vocals
Billy Lostland: electric bassoon, vocals
Jon Coe: keyboard, vocals
Peter Prescott: drums
Mollasian Chorus: barroom Chants.
Side A: White Stains
Side B: Is Chesty Dead?
